设置vista和win7进入Debug模式
2018-01-03 01:15
696 查看
转载请标明是引用于 http://blog.csdn.net/chenyujing1234
欢迎大家拍砖
设置vista和win7进入Debug模式:
1. bcdedit /copy {current} /d DebugEntry
正常情况下提示:
![](http://img.my.csdn.net/uploads/201210/19/1350634797_2842.jpg)
如果出现以下提示:
![](http://img.my.csdn.net/uploads/201210/19/1350634348_6805.jpg)
解决方法:
因为用户账户控制UAC,导致了cmd命令默认无管理员权限;只需在cmd上右键以管理员方式运行即可,或者控制面板-用户账户-用户账户控制,拖动到最低档确认重启后也可以。
![](http://img.my.csdn.net/uploads/201210/19/1350634693_8614.jpg)
这里的debugentry 新的启动项的描述。
经过这一步后,我们就可以在启动时看到有两个启动选项了。
2. bcdedit
会显示 各项的详细信息,找到 decription 为 DebugEntry 的项,找到GUID,记下值
![](http://img.my.csdn.net/uploads/201210/19/1350634852_2577.jpg)
3. bcdedit /debug DebugEntry的guid on
打开调试选项,红色的为你可以改的内容
![](http://img.my.csdn.net/uploads/201210/19/1350634934_2170.jpg)
注意:
如果有其他的操作系统使用:bcdedit /displayorder {current} {GUID} 给启动菜单排序
如果Debug模式不能调试使用:bcdedit /dbgsettings serial baudrate:115200 debugport:1 试试。
![](http://img.my.csdn.net/uploads/201210/19/1350635001_5694.jpg)
4、设置输出打印消息
在H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ager目录下新建一项Debug Print Filter
在Debug Print Filter之下建立类型为DWORD、名称为DEFAULT、值为8的条目。名称DEFAULT是大小写相关的,如果建成Default好像会启动不了。
重启OS
要进行这个设置的原因是,在vista和win7下面,KdPrint宏的意义被修改成了按照条件打印消息,即以下两条程序语句是等效的
KdPrint ( Format, arguments )
KdPrintEx ( DPFLTR_DEFAULT_ID, DPFLTR_INFO_LEVEL, Format, arguments )
http://blog.csdn.net/chenyujing1234/article/details/8090297
欢迎大家拍砖
设置vista和win7进入Debug模式:
1. bcdedit /copy {current} /d DebugEntry
正常情况下提示:
![](http://img.my.csdn.net/uploads/201210/19/1350634797_2842.jpg)
如果出现以下提示:
![](http://img.my.csdn.net/uploads/201210/19/1350634348_6805.jpg)
解决方法:
因为用户账户控制UAC,导致了cmd命令默认无管理员权限;只需在cmd上右键以管理员方式运行即可,或者控制面板-用户账户-用户账户控制,拖动到最低档确认重启后也可以。
![](http://img.my.csdn.net/uploads/201210/19/1350634693_8614.jpg)
这里的debugentry 新的启动项的描述。
经过这一步后,我们就可以在启动时看到有两个启动选项了。
2. bcdedit
会显示 各项的详细信息,找到 decription 为 DebugEntry 的项,找到GUID,记下值
![](http://img.my.csdn.net/uploads/201210/19/1350634852_2577.jpg)
3. bcdedit /debug DebugEntry的guid on
打开调试选项,红色的为你可以改的内容
![](http://img.my.csdn.net/uploads/201210/19/1350634934_2170.jpg)
注意:
如果有其他的操作系统使用:bcdedit /displayorder {current} {GUID} 给启动菜单排序
如果Debug模式不能调试使用:bcdedit /dbgsettings serial baudrate:115200 debugport:1 试试。
![](http://img.my.csdn.net/uploads/201210/19/1350635001_5694.jpg)
4、设置输出打印消息
在H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ager目录下新建一项Debug Print Filter
在Debug Print Filter之下建立类型为DWORD、名称为DEFAULT、值为8的条目。名称DEFAULT是大小写相关的,如果建成Default好像会启动不了。
重启OS
要进行这个设置的原因是,在vista和win7下面,KdPrint宏的意义被修改成了按照条件打印消息,即以下两条程序语句是等效的
KdPrint ( Format, arguments )
KdPrintEx ( DPFLTR_DEFAULT_ID, DPFLTR_INFO_LEVEL, Format, arguments )
http://blog.csdn.net/chenyujing1234/article/details/8090297
相关文章推荐
- 设置vista和win7进入Debug模式
- MyEclipse默认进入debug模式,而不弹出提示框,怎么设置它才能弹出呢?
- 【电脑技巧】远程访问-注意设置关键步骤修改电源计划取消进入睡眠模式
- WIN7下如何进入debug
- win7设置护眼模式
- 程序猿软件开发保护眼睛,win7设置窗口护眼模式?
- eclipse不能进入debug模式的解决方法
- 编译模式不对,导致无法进入Debug
- myeclipse 总是自动进入debug模式
- 如何设置Android系统中的BT2.1 device到SSP的DEBUG模式
- Fedora15设置开机进入终端模式
- Activity设置为启动模式为singletask第二次进入activity getintent获取不到问题
- 关于win7升级到win10导致Oracel VM VirtualBox中安装rhel6虚拟机网卡设置仅主机模式时不能开机的问题
- 怎么设置Win7不待机 Win7进入待机状态会断网的解决方法
- win7休眠后打开电脑提示bootmgr is missing,且无法按f2进入BIOS模式解决
- [Win7]MS秘密 - 上帝模式 (GodMode)- Vista,Win7,Windows2008
- Win7怎么进入安全模式 三种轻松进入Win7安全模式方法
- 如何设置Android系统中的BT2.1 device到SSP的DEBUG模式
- win7 设置 开始菜单 程序 为经典模式
- [cmake]如何设置Debug和Release编译模式